The combination appears in user reports for concurrent support of immune and metabolic layers without overlapping mechanisms.\n\n## What the evidence actually shows\n\nHuman trials for Thymosin Alpha-1 exist in sepsis, chronic hepatitis B, cancer adjunct therapy, and COVID-19 settings. A 2024 narrative review summarized outcomes across more than 11,000 human subjects in over 30 trials, noting consistent tolerability and immune-modulating effects in those populations (preclinical and human data separated below). GLP-1 agonist trials number in the tens of thousands with large cardiovascular outcome studies showing weight loss and glycemic control.\n\nNo published human trials directly test Thymosin Alpha-1 added to GLP-1 agonist regimens. Claims linking the two remain mechanistic or anecdotal.\n\n## What scientists say\n\nReviews describe Thymosin Alpha-1 as an immune modulator that enhances T-cell function and reduces excessive inflammation in select clinical contexts. GLP-1 literature emphasizes incretin effects on beta-cell function and central appetite centers. No large volume of detailed outcome reports appears in recent searches.\n\n## What we do not know\n\nDirect synergy, optimal sequencing, or effects on specific GLP-1 side-effect profiles remain unstudied in humans. Long-term outcomes when both are combined lack dedicated trials. Individual immune baselines vary widely.\n\n## Safety and limits\n\nThymosin Alpha-1 shows good tolerability in reviewed human trials with over 11,000 participants. GLP-1 agonists carry established gastrointestinal and other class effects documented in large trials. Any combined use occurs outside approved labeling for either agent. Evidence grading separates robust human metabolic data for GLP-1 agonists from immune data for Thymosin Alpha-1; cross-application stays speculative absent targeted studies.","register":"source_ledger","tags":["peptide","matrix"],"category":null,"style":{},"claims":[{"id":"c1","text":"Thymosin Alpha-1 has been studied in human clinical trials involving over 11,000 subjects across more than 30 trials for immune modulation in sepsis, hepatitis, cancer, and COVID-19.","section":"What the evidence actually shows","tier":"human","source_ids":["s1"],"source_status":"sourced","why_material":"Establishes volume of human data separate from animal or mechanistic work."},{"id":"c2","text":"No published human trials test the combination of Thymosin Alpha-1 with GLP-1 agonists.","section":"What the evidence actually shows","tier":"human","source_ids":["s2"],"source_status":"sourced","why_material":"Clarifies absence of direct evidence for the cross."},{"id":"c3","text":"GLP-1 agonists produce weight loss and glycemic improvements in large randomized human trials.","section":"Why GLP-1 agonists (class) matters for you","tier":"human","source_ids":["s3"],"source_status":"sourced","why_material":"Grounds the metabolic benefit claim in trial data."},{"id":"c4","text":"Reddit users report concurrent use of Thymosin Alpha-1 and tirzepatide for subjective immune and inflammation support in long-COVID and autoimmune contexts.","section":"What people say on Reddit","tier":"anecdotal","source_ids":["s4"],"source_status":"sourced","why_material":"Documents real-world anecdotes without implying efficacy."}],"sources":[{"id":"s1","type":"review","url":"https://p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/38308608/","title":"Comprehensive Review of the Safety and Efficacy of Thymosin Alpha 1 in Human Clinical Trials","quote":"This study aims to assess the safety and efficacy of Thymosin Alpha 1 (Tα1) through a comprehensive narrative review of clinical studies involving over 11 000 human subjects in more than 30 trials.","summary":"2024 review of Tα1 human data.","claim_ids":["c1"]},{"id":"s2","type":"other","url":"https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/books/NBK551568/","title":"Glucagon-Like Peptide-1 Receptor Agonists - StatPearls","quote":"Gl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) agonists are a class of medications utilized to treat type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) and obesity.","summary":"Standard GLP-1 review with no mention of Tα1.","claim_ids":["c2"]},{"id":"s3","type":"clinical_trial","url":"https://www.nejm.org/doi/full/10.1056/NEJMoa2107519","title":"Tirzepatide versus Semaglutide Once Weekly in Patients with Type 2 Diabetes","quote":"Tirzepatide is a dual glucose-dependent insulinotropic polypeptide and gl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ist...","summary":"Large human trial on GLP-1 class efficacy.","claim_ids":["c3"]},{"id":"s4","type":"reddit","url":"https://www.reddit.com/r/covidlonghaulers/comments/1r5ekd8/5_years_long_covid_thymosin_alpha_1_peptide_wow/","title":"5 Years Long Covid - Thymosin Alpha 1 Peptide - WOW!","quote":"I have now gotten on a microdose of a GLP-1 (Tirz) and it has been way more effective than KPV at lower doses.","summary":"User anecdote combining TA1 and tirzepatide.","claim_ids":["c4"]}],"prov":{"model":"grok/grok-4.3","action":"write"}}
